A Masterclass Certificate in Behavior Modification for Learning Disabilities equips participants with the skills to effectively address behavioral challenges faced by students with diverse learning needs. The program emphasizes practical application, focusing on evidence-based strategies and techniques.
Learning outcomes include a comprehensive understanding of learning disabilities, the ability to design and implement behavior modification plans, and the skills to analyze data and adapt interventions. Students will also learn about positive behavior supports and functional behavioral assessments – key elements in effective special education.

A Masterclass Certificate in Behavior Modification for Learning Disabilities holds significant value in today's UK market. The increasing prevalence of learning disabilities necessitates skilled professionals capable of implementing effective behavioral interventions. According to recent studies, approximately 2.2 million children and young people in the UK have a special educational need (SEN). A large proportion of these require tailored behavioral strategies. This creates a high demand for specialists qualified in behavior modification techniques, leading to increased job opportunities in education, healthcare, and related fields.
